Amiral Byng is a historical novel authored by Ahmet Mithat Efendi (1844-1912), one of the prolific and prominent figures of Turkish literature. Prepared for publication by İnci Enginün and published by Dergâh Publications as part of its "Turkish Literature" series, the work addresses the trial process and execution of the British Admiral John Byng following his defeat against the French fleet at Minorca during the Seven Years' War, which took place in the mid-eighteenth Century. This work, which Ahmet Mithat Efendi adapted into a novel from a French play, presents a literary interpretation of a historical event. The book, published in April 2014, consists of 217 pages.

Content and Thematic Structure

The novel “Amiral Byng” centers on the siege of Minorca, an important naval front of the Seven Years' War that began in 1756, and a tragic event that followed. The main subject of the book is the trial by court-martial and eventual execution of the British Admiral John Byng after he lost Minorca to the French. Ahmet Mithat Efendi adapted this event into novel form, inspired by a French play titled “Le Amiral de l'escadre bleue.” Elements such as Byng's military strategies, the difficult conditions of the war, failures in the chain of command, and political intrigues are treated in the work. The details of the trial process, the accusations, the defenses, and the political atmosphere of the period form the plot of the novel.


The book not only recounts a historical event but also interrogates universal themes such as justice, responsibility, patriotism, and the helplessness of the individual against the system. Through the fate of Admiral Byng, subjects like military discipline, leadership qualities, and the risks of making mistakes are also addressed indirectly. As Ahmet Mithat Efendi literary revives the tragic end of a historical figure, he invites the reader to gain a perspective on the events of the period and the psychology of the characters.

Language and Style

The language and style in Ahmet Mithat Efendi's “Amiral Byng” carry the characteristics of the Tanzimat period novel tradition. The author uses a plain and understandable language with a didactic approach aimed at informing and educating the reader. The narrative is fluid, and the plot is constructed to engage the reader's interest. In the text, which reflects the features of the literary Turkish of the period, historical and military terms can occasionally be found. The style, while recounting events from an objective distance, also offers clues to the inner worlds of the characters. In this work, which the author adapted into a novel from a French play, a literary transformation has been achieved while preserving the dramatic structure of the original text.

The Author's Position and the Significance of the Work

Ahmet Mithat Efendi was one of the most productive and popular writers of the Tanzimat period, producing works in many genres such as the novel, short story, article, and drama. He is considered a “Hace-i Evvel” (First Teacher) who undertook the mission of educating and enlightening the public. “Amiral Byng” is an example that demonstrates Ahmet Mithat Efendi's translation and adaptation skills, as well as his interest in historical events. The work is important for introducing the Turkish reader to historical and social events that took place in the West. The novel not only tells the tragic story of Admiral Byng but also opens a window onto the European politics and military life of the period. In this respect, it is a study of interest for examination both within Ahmet Mithat Efendi's oeuvre and among the early examples of translation and adaptation in Turkish literature.
